西门子系统斜边怎么编程

时间:2025-03-05 00:39:04 明星趣事

在西门子系统中,编程斜边通常涉及以下步骤:

确定工件坐标系:

首先,需要确定工件坐标系,以便在编程时能够准确地定位和描述斜边的位置和方向。

定义切削工具:

接下来,需要定义切削工具,包括刀具的尺寸和形状,以便在编程时能够准确地描述切削过程。

编写G代码:

G代码是用于控制机床运动的指令集。在编写G代码时,需要描述斜边的起点、终点和路径。这通常涉及到使用G0(快速定位)、G1(直线插补)、G2(顺圆插补)和G3(逆圆插补)等指令。

编写M代码:

M代码用于控制机床的辅助功能,如换刀、冷却液开关等。在编写M代码时,需要确保这些功能与G代码协调一致。

进行程序验证:

在完成G代码和M代码的编写后,需要进行程序验证,以确保斜边的编程正确无误,并且能够安全、准确地执行。

此外,还可以使用一些特殊的函数块来实现斜坡功能,例如基于定时器的斜坡发生器函数块FB5008_RampGenerator,或者更新版的斜坡发生器FB5028_RampGeneratorEx,这些函数块可以设置初始值、目标值及斜坡时间,并通过计算输出每次定时器计时达到时应当增加的数值单位,从而实现斜边的平滑变化。

建议在编程斜边时,仔细检查图纸标注,确保理解斜边的方向和角度,并根据实际情况调整G代码和M代码,以实现精确的斜边加工。同时,进行充分的程序验证,确保加工过程的安全性和准确性。